#93f410 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#93f410 is composed of 57.6% red, 95.7%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.4%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 85.5 degrees, a saturation of 91.2% and a lightness of 51%. #93f410 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ff20 with #27e900. Closest websafe color is: #99ff00.

#93f410 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#93f410 has RGB values of R:147, G:244,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0, Y:0.93,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 9696272.
